AI-assisted profile summarySignature technique
Dr. Friedman utilizes the deep plane facelift technique, which involves releasing and repositioning deeper facial structures, specifically the sub-SMAS layer. This method aims to provide results that appear natural and are designed for longevity by addressing foundational tissues. The technique necessitates a precise understanding of facial anatomy, including the pathways of nerves and blood vessels, for safe and effective manipulation of these deeper planes.

Ask Dr. Friedman about pricingPeer-reviewed papers indexed in PubMed and OpenAlex. Most recent 5 of 16 on record.
- Hyperbaric Oxygen Preconditioning Can Reduce Postabdominoplasty Complications: A Retrospective Cohort Study.Plastic and reconstructive surgery. Global open · 2019 · first author
- Surgical Site Infection Risk Factor Analysis in Postbariatric Patients Undergoing Body Contouring Surgery: A Nested Case-Control Study.Annals of plastic surgery · 2019 · co-author
- Abdominal Contouring and Combining Procedures.Clinics in plastic surgery · 2019 · first author
- Is There an Association Between Hyperbaric Oxygen Therapy and Improved Outcome of Deep Chemical Peeling? A Randomized Pilot Clinical StudyPlastic Surgery · 2018 · senior author
- Body contouring procedures in three or more anatomical areas are associated with long-term body mass index decrease in massive weight loss patients: A retrospective cohort studyJournal of Plastic Reconstructive & Aesthetic Surgery · 2017 · senior author

The deep plane facelift technique represents a significant advancement over traditional facelift methods. This procedure involves releasing and repositioning the deeper facial structures, specifically the sub-SMAS layer (the fibromuscular layer beneath the superficial fat), to achieve more natural and longer-lasting results.

Dr. Friedman's Surgical Approach
Deep plane facelift surgery represents the most advanced approach to facial rejuvenation currently available. The technique involves dissecting beneath the SMAS layer (superficial musculoaponeurotic system) to release and reposition the deeper facial structures that have descended with age.

MD Friedman's surgical approach likely incorporates the fundamental principles of deep plane technique. This includes creating a continuous tissue plane that extends from the midface to the neck, allowing for comprehensive repositioning of facial tissues as a single unit rather than in separate layers.

Recovery Expectations
Deep plane facelift recovery follows a predictable timeline requiring patient commitment to optimal healing. The first week typically involves the most significant swelling and bruising, with patients needing dedicated rest and careful adherence to post-operative instructions.

Weeks two through four mark gradual improvement in facial appearance. Swelling subsides progressively, bruising fades, and patients begin recognizing their refreshed facial contours as tissues settle into new positions.
